Re: Battery keeps dying?
Your alternator should be putting out at least 13.5V not 12. Try this test, read the voltage at the battery with the engine not running and then againg with engine running, it should be at least 1.5 V higher with the engine running and if not it's a bad alternator and you should get it tested. Pep boys and Advanced auto will test it free of charge.
